比特币钱包的数据库技术
2026-03-15
随着比特币等数字货币的逐步普及,越来越多的人开始关注比特币钱包的选择与使用。比特币钱包不仅仅是存储数字资产的工具,更是与区块链技术融为一体的重要应用。了解钱包的工作原理和数据库背景,有助于用户更好地保护自己的资产,选择合适的使用方案。
--- ### 比特币钱包的基本概念 #### 什么是比特币钱包?比特币钱包是一种用于存储比特币及其他加密货币的程序或应用。每个钱包都有一个或多个密钥,用户通过这些密钥进行比特币的交易。钱包的存在使用户能管理自己的货币,而不是仅仅依赖于交易所等第三方平台。
#### 钱包的工作原理比特币钱包的工作原理相对简单,用户需生成一对密钥:一个公钥和一个私钥。公钥类似于银行账户,可以与他人共享以接收比特币;而私钥则是进行交易所必需的,系统会利用它签署交易。因此,保障私钥的安全性至关重要。任何拥有私钥的人都可以控制与之关联的比特币。
--- ### 比特币钱包的类型 #### 热钱包热钱包指的是始终联网的数字钱包,适合日常交易,使用方便,但因互联网连接容易受到攻击,因此安全性较低。
#### 冷钱包冷钱包不与互联网连接,适合长期储存比特币。虽然不便于频繁交易,但其安全性方式十分有效。
#### 硬件钱包硬件钱包是一种物理设备,用户将私钥保存在设备中。即便计算机被入侵,攻击者也无法获取私钥。
#### 软件钱包软件钱包是安装在电脑或手机上的应用。其安全性取决于软件的设计和使用情况,需定期更新。
#### 纸钱包纸钱包是将私钥和公钥打印在纸张上,安全性高,但物理保管成为关键。
--- ### 数据库技术在比特币钱包中的应用 #### 区块链作为数据库比特币的核心是区块链,这是一个去中心化的分布式账本,记录所有的交易信息。区块链的特性确保了数据的不可篡改性和透明性。
#### 钱包的数据库结构比特币钱包的数据库结构以区块链为基础,但还需要额外数据支持,如用户详细信息、交易历史等。这些信息通常存储在本地数据库或云端数据库中。
#### 数据库的安全性考虑在数据库设计中,安全性是首要考虑的因素。钱包通常采用加密技术保护数据,同时设有多重验证机制以增强安全性。
--- ### 如何选择合适的比特币钱包 #### 根据使用场景选择钱包选择合适的比特币钱包时,首先要明确自己的使用场景。对于日常交易,热钱包可能更方便;而对于长期持有,冷钱包或硬件钱包将是更安全的选择。
#### 安全性与便利性的综合考量在选择钱包时,安全性与便利性常常需要平衡。一个安全性高但使用不便的钱包,可能导致用户无法合理使用其资产。
#### 用户体验与支持用户体验是影响钱包选择的重要因素,易用的界面和良好的客户支持都是值得考虑的要素。
--- ### 比特币钱包的安全性分析 #### 常见安全风险分析随着比特币的价值不断上升,针对钱包的攻击也愈发频繁。网络钓鱼、恶意软件、以及用户自身的管理失误都是常见的安全风险。
#### 如何保障钱包安全用户应当定期更新软件,启用双重验证,避免在公共网络中进行敏感操作。此外,备份私钥和钱包数据也是确保安全的重要措施。
#### 双重验证与多重签名机制双重验证是提升钱包安全的有效措施之一。用户可以设置多重签名,即一笔交易需多个密钥共同签署,这样即使某个密钥被盗,交易也无法轻松完成。
--- ### 未来技术趋势与发展 #### 新兴的钱包技术随着技术的发展,比特币钱包也在不断创新。从多重签名到生物识别技术的应用,新兴钱包技术不断涌现,用户体验持续提升。
#### 去中心化钱包的未来去中心化钱包不依赖于第三方机构,用户可以完全掌控自己的资产。虽然仍面临一定的安全和技术挑战,但在去中心化趋势下,这种钱包的需求正在上升。
--- ### 总结在选择比特币钱包时,用户应综合考虑安全性、便利性、以及个人使用需求。无论是热钱包还是冷钱包,了解它们各自的特点与适用场景,有助于用户找到最合适的选择,从而在这个数字货币时代更好地管理自己的资产。
### 相关问题分析 #### 比特币钱包的安全性如何评估?在选择比特币钱包时,安全性是一个非常重要的因素。首先,用户应该了解钱包的种类及其安全特点。热钱包因常在线而面临诈骗和黑客攻击的风险,适合频繁交易;而冷钱包、硬件钱包则相对安全,适用于长期存储。
其次,评估钱包提供的安全特性,如两步验证、私钥管理和备份选项等。比较不同钱包在安全方面的口碑和用户反馈,可以帮助用户做出更明智的选择。
最后,用户自身的使用习惯也至关重要。确保软件及时更新、保持警惕不在公共场合操作等都是保障钱包安全的重要举措。
#### 如何选择适合初学者的比特币钱包?对于初学者来说,选一个简单易用的比特币钱包至关重要。选择过程建议如下:
1. **界面友好**: 选择用户界面设计简洁、容易上手的应用,使得初学者能够快速了解功能。
2. **基础功能完整**: 初学者不需要过多复杂的功能,应选择提供基础存储与转账功能的钱包。
3. **良好支持与资源**: 有良好用户文档和支持的应用,能够帮助初学者解决问题并逐步深入了解比特币。
4. **安全性与隐私**: 确保所选钱包有良好的安全记录,不会轻易丢失用户的私钥和资金。
#### 比特币钱包的使用常见错误有哪些?使用比特币钱包时,很多用户常常犯一些错误,这里总结几个常见的:
1. **未备份私钥**: 许多用户在创建钱包后,忽视了备份私钥,导致钱包丢失后无法恢复资产。
2. **在公共网络操作**: 在公共Wi-Fi下进行比特币交易容易被黑客攻击,用户应尽量避免此类操作。
3. **缺乏软件更新**: 忽视钱包软件的更新会导致安全漏洞,定期检查和更新十分重要。
4. **轻信第三方**: 有些用户容易受到欺诈信息的诱惑,尤其在使用热钱包时更需谨慎,以免财产损失。
#### 长期存储比特币使用什么钱包最安全?对于长期存储比特币,用户通常会选择冷钱包或硬件钱包:
1. **冷钱包**: 冷钱包不常连接到互联网,使其更加安全,但不适合频繁交易。它能有效避免黑客入侵和网络攻击。
2. **硬件钱包**: 这种设备能将私钥安全地存储在本地。即使连接到不安全的电脑,私钥也不会暴露,因而成为了许多专家推荐的选择。
3. **纸钱包**: 选择将私钥生成并打印到纸上,除非极端情况下丢失或损坏,否则很难被攻击。这是保守的存储方式。
#### 为什么有些钱包不支持所有的比特币交易?不同的比特币钱包有不同的区块链协议,很多钱包只支持特定类型的比特币或其他加密货币,同时因技术差异,某些功能也可能不被支持:
1. **协议差异**: 比特币有多个标准,不同钱包可能支持不同的协议,如BIP32/BIP44等,影响互通性。
2. **功能限制**: 一些轻钱包为了加快速度和降低存储需求,可能只提供特定的功能,不支持复杂交易。
3. **服务策略**: 有些钱包为了保护用户,故意不支持某些高风险或较少使用的交易,确保服务的稳定与安全。
#### 去中心化钱包和中心化钱包的比较?去中心化钱包和中心化钱包是两种重要的比特币钱包类型,各有优缺点:
1. **去中心化钱包**: 用户掌控自己的私钥和资产,不依赖于第三方服务。虽然安全性高,但若用户丢失私钥,资产将无法恢复。
2. **中心化钱包**: 受托于第三方机构,操作方便,但存在风险。一旦服务被攻击或不当管理,用户的资金也可能面临损失。
3. **选择依据**: 用户应根据个人需求进行选择, 若强调安全性,则建议首选去中心化钱包;而若强调交易便利性,则中心化钱包可能更为合适。
#### 关于比特币钱包的未来发展趋势是什么?比特币钱包未来将呈现以下几个发展趋势:
1. **技术创新**: 随着区块链技术和加密技术的进步,钱包的安全性和功能将不断增加。例如,生物识别技术的应用可能成为趋势。
2. **去中心化提升**: 更多用户希望在不受第三方控制情况下使用自己的资产,去中心化钱包将日益普及。
3. **跨链钱包发展**: 随着多种加密资产的兴起,跨链钱包可以支持多种数字货币的管理,将成为用户的需求。
4. **可扩展性与用户体验**: 面向普通用户的应用程序将注重用户界面设计和使用体验,使更多人能轻松使用比特币等数字货币。
--- 以上便是关于比特币钱包及其数据库技术解析的内容。希望能帮助读者更好地理解比特币钱包的选择与使用。